Matt wrote:yes, another one of these. I figured theres enough fans and haters to keep this alive.
So what did we do this off-season. Added Dale Davis (replacing Elden Campbell), added Maurice Evans, and some rookies. Nothing major really, but enough refreshments to win another championship.
The big move though was adding Saunders, who apparently will push for more running, which will be good given the Pistons defense will create opportunities, and all the starters can finish on the break. Saunders will also force more out of Rasheed, which is great news.
I see the team winning 55 reg season games, finishing 3rd in the East, but eventually returning to the Finals. Still the best Starting 5 in the L, but now with a bench (Davis, Hunter, Evans, McDyess make for a good rotation). Oh, and Milicic will actually see the light of day.
